Lord Chancelier
The Lord Chancelier of Great Britain ( Lord High Chancellor off Great Britain or Lord Chancellor in English) is one most important senior officials of the government of the the United Kingdom. As a Large Officer of State, it is named by the British monarch on council of the Prime Minister. The habit wants that it is always a Lord, although there does not exist any legal obstacle with the designation of a commoner.
The responsibilities for the Lord Chancelier are vast: they include the presidency of the House of Lords, the participation in the ministerial cabinet and the supervision of the judicial Power. Criticisms concerning the extent of these capacities led the Prime Minister Tony Blair to propose the abolition of this function: a constitutional reform of 2005 results in to transfer a big part from being able to other institutional characters.
